Bill Sweatt Ice hockey player
William Joseph Sweatt (born September 21, 1988) is an American ice hockey left winger. He currently plays with the Brynäs IF of the Swedish Hockey League (SHL).Sweatt played junior hockey with the United States National Development Program and college hockey with the Colorado College Tigers. Selected 38th overall in the 2007 NHL Entry Draft by the Chicago Blackhawks, he became a free agent after going unsigned by the club. In 2010, he signed with the Canucks. As a roller hockey player, Sweatt has competed internationally with Team USA, winning a gold medal at the 2006 World InLine Championships. His older brother Lee Sweatt is a retired hockey player; the two have played with each other with the Colorado College Tigers and the Manitoba Moose.
